Compounding Pharmacy Technician
Job Title: Compounding Pharmacy Technician Location: Downtown PHX Overview: We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Pharmacy Technician to join our dynamic healthcare team. This role offers the opportunity to work in both outpatient and inpatient settings, supporting critical pharmacy operations under the supervision of a licensed pharmacist. If you’re passionate about patient care, pharmacy excellence, and professional growth, we’d love to hear from you. Key Responsibilities: + Prepare and dispense medications accurately in compliance with state and federal regulations, including USP <795>, <797>, and <800> standards. + Manage automated dispensing systems (Omnicell/Pyxis), ensuring proper stocking and functionality. + Deliver medications promptly to clinical areas to support efficient patient care. + Maintain inventory levels of medications and supplies, ensuring availability and accuracy. + Participate in quality assurance initiatives and maintain required documentation. + Provide clerical and administrative support to ensure smooth pharmacy operations. + Collaborate with pharmacists,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to promote safe and coordinated care. + Maintain aseptic technique and handle controlled substances responsibly. + Stay current with departmental updates and complete required educational modules. + Opportunity for cross-training in specialty areas such as outpatient neurology infusion and inpatient pharmacy. Required Skills & Experience: + Active CPhT certification + Minimum 1 year of infusion compounding experience + Must have experience with Omnicell or Pyxis automated shelving systems + Proficiency in compounding, data entry, medication processing, and inventory management + IV/Chemotherapy compounding experience preferred Work Environment: + Schedule: Monday to Friday, 7:00 AM – 3:30 PM + Hazardous chemotherapy compounding is performed at the main hospital and couriered to the cancer center daily Pay and Benefits The pay range for this position is $22.00 - $28.00/hr.
